I would like to add my support to a letter in the Globe on July 18 under ‘Bike menace’.
I completely agree that it is becoming very difficult to dodge the bikes on pavements and the lack of consideration from some of the cyclists is truly appalling.
Also, some cyclists are ignoring the pedestrian crossing and cycling through red lights.
This has happened to me twice outside Morrisons in New Brighton and also at the top of Rowson Street.
Is there nothing that can be done to help and protect us pedestrians?
J Macdonald,
Wallasey
